<description>That term &amp;quot;Comrades&amp;quot; has been a bone of contention in the VFW for some time. In fact, several years ago there was a resolution at the VFW National Convention to change that means of addressing fellow members, due to the similarity to the way commies address each other. The term is somewhat traditional, dating back to WW-1 when soldiers were considered &amp;quot;Comrades in Arms.&amp;quot; The resolution to change it to something else was defeated with the reasoning that the commies weren&amp;#039;t going to dictate political correctness (or the term used at the time) to the VFW. The odd sounding term has continued to this day, though it is really the antithesis to the commie version.
